三步搭建个人NAS存储系统:RR引导工具全攻略
场景价值分析:个人与小型团队的存储解决方案
在数据爆炸的时代,个人与小型团队面临着存储需求增长与预算限制的双重挑战。RR引导工具作为一款开源的预安装与恢复环境,为x86/x64架构设备提供了专业级NAS系统部署方案。无论是家庭用户构建媒体中心,还是小型办公团队实现文件共享,抑或是开发者搭建测试环境,RR引导都能以极低的成本实现企业级存储体验。
核心优势解析:为何选择RR引导方案
智能硬件适配系统
RR引导内置先进的硬件检测算法,能够自动识别处理器型号、内存配置、存储设备类型及网络适配器状态,确保系统与硬件环境的无缝匹配。
多语言支持体系
项目已完善支持14种语言环境,包括中文(简体/繁体)、英文、日文、韩文、德文、法文、俄文等,满足全球用户的本地化需求。
灵活部署选项
支持物理机与虚拟化环境部署,提供USB/SATA/NVMe等多种启动盘类型选择,适配不同硬件场景。
实施流程图解:从零开始的部署步骤
准备阶段:镜像获取与硬件检测
镜像下载
从项目仓库克隆最新代码库:
git clone https://gitcode.com/gh_mirrors/rr2/rr
硬件兼容性检查
确保设备满足以下最低配置:
- CPU:Intel/AMD x86/x64架构处理器
- 内存:至少4GB RAM
- 存储:32GB以上容量的SATA接口硬盘
- 启动设备:USB/SATA/NVMe存储介质
制作阶段:启动盘创建与配置
镜像写入工具选择
推荐使用BalenaEtcher或Rufus等工具,将下载的镜像文件写入启动设备。
启动盘类型选择
- USB接口:适合临时测试或移动部署
- SATA接口:适合固定安装的稳定性需求
- NVMe接口:适合追求高性能的场景
部署阶段:系统安装与参数配置
启动设备选择
进入BIOS/UEFI设置,将启动盘设置为第一启动项,保存并重启。
DSM版本选择
根据硬件配置选择合适的DSM版本,系统会自动匹配最佳驱动配置。
关键参数设置
- 网络配置:建议使用静态IP便于管理
- 存储配置:选择RAID类型(单盘/RAID0/RAID1)
- 用户设置:创建管理员账户并启用两步验证
进阶配置策略:提升系统性能与安全性
虚拟化环境部署指南
在Proxmox VE中使用一键安装脚本:
bash scripts/pve.sh --bltype usb --onboot --efi
参数说明:
--bltype:指定启动盘类型(sata/usb/nvme)--onboot:设置虚拟机开机自启动--efi:启用UEFI引导模式
系统优化配置
内存管理
- 启用内存压缩提升可用空间
- 根据使用场景分配2-8GB内存资源
- 配置适当的交换空间(建议为内存大小的50%)
存储优化
- 使用SSD作为缓存盘加速读写
- 定期执行文件系统检查
- 启用TRIM功能延长SSD寿命
数据安全策略
定期备份机制
通过系统内置工具备份关键配置:
./scripts/backup.sh --config --system
版本升级管理
保持系统更新获取最新功能与安全补丁:
./update-check.sh
对比分析:RR引导与传统部署方案
| 特性 | RR引导方案 | 传统部署方式 |
|---|---|---|
| 部署难度 | 简单(3步完成) | 复杂(需专业知识) |
| 硬件兼容性 | 自动识别适配 | 需手动配置驱动 |
| 部署时间 | 5-10分钟 | 30分钟以上 |
| 多语言支持 | 内置14种语言 | 通常仅支持英文 |
| 维护成本 | 低(自动更新) | 高(需手动维护) |
常见问题解决:部署与使用中的关键提示
启动失败排查步骤
-
硬件兼容性验证
检查CPU是否支持64位虚拟化技术,在BIOS中启用VT-d/AMD-V功能。 -
引导盘检测
使用工具验证镜像完整性,尝试更换不同品牌的USB设备。 -
BIOS设置检查
- 禁用安全启动(Secure Boot)
- 启用传统模式或UEFI模式(根据镜像类型选择)
- 确保SATA控制器模式为AHCI
性能优化建议
- 网络优化:配置Jumbo Frame提升局域网传输速度
- 电源管理:根据使用场景选择平衡或高性能模式
- 服务管理:禁用不必要的系统服务释放资源
总结:打造专属NAS系统的理想选择
RR引导工具通过智能化的硬件适配、简洁的部署流程和丰富的功能配置,彻底改变了传统NAS系统的部署门槛。无论是技术新手还是资深用户,都能通过这套工具快速构建稳定可靠的存储解决方案。随着项目的持续更新,RR引导将继续优化硬件支持和用户体验,为个人与小型团队提供更强大的存储工具。
通过本文介绍的三步部署法,您已经掌握了从准备到配置的完整流程。建议定期关注项目更新,获取最新的硬件支持和功能增强,让您的NAS系统始终保持最佳状态。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0194
cann-learning-hubCANN 学习中心仓,支持在线互动运行、边学边练,提供教程、示例与优化方案,一站式助力昇腾开发者快速上手。Jupyter Notebook0121
MiMo-V2.5-Pro-FP4-DFlashMiMo-V2.5-Pro-FP4-DFlash 是驱动 MiMo-V2.5-Pro-UltraSpeed 的底层模型: FP4 量化骨干网络:对 MoE 专家采用 MXFP4 量化,同时保持模型其他部分的更高精度,在几乎无损质量的前提下,显著减小模型体积并降低内存带宽压力。 BF16 DFlash 草稿生成器:用于块扩散推测解码,每次前向传播可生成一整个块的 tokens,并让骨干网络一步完成验证。 两者协同作用,既降低了每参数的位宽,又减少了骨干网络前向传播的次数,而这两者正是万亿参数模型解码过程中的两大主要成本来源。Python00
JoyAI-EchoJoyAI-Echo,这是一个独立的、仅用于推理的版本,旨在实现分钟级多镜头音视频生成。它采用了经过蒸馏的DMD生成器、配对的跨模态记忆以及故事级别的一致性。其性能的核心在于,一个跨模态视听记忆库能够在长达五分钟的视频中保持角色外观和语音音色的一致性。同时,一个训练后处理流程将基于记忆的强化学习与分布匹配蒸馏相结合,实现了7.5倍的速度提升,显著增强了视觉质量和对齐效果。00
AstrBot✨ 易上手的多平台 LLM 聊天机器人及开发框架 ✨ 平台支持 QQ、QQ频道、Telegram、微信、企微、飞书 | OpenAI、DeepSeek、Gemini、硅基流动、月之暗面、Ollama、OneAPI、Dify 等。附带 WebUI。Python05
handy-ollama动手学Ollama,CPU玩转大模型部署,在线阅读地址:https://datawhalechina.github.io/handy-ollama/Jupyter Notebook06
